We are looking for an Esports Program Assistant who is ready to jump into the thick of it.

Hiring Salary is $18.00/hour.

This position is classified as VHNE (Variable Hour Non-Benefit Employee) where the selected candidate will work less than 29 hours per week. This position does not provide medical benefits. This position earns sick leave in accordance with the Healthy Families and Workplace Act.

PRIMARY D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Leads the day-to-day activities of the esports programming including programs classes camps drop-in and events; facilitates esports camps events.
  • Expands and maintains internal and external professional partnerships needed to facilitate esports programs classes camps and events.
  • Develops and maintains positive and healthy relationships with participants and the community by actively engaging with them and responding to their needs and interests.
  • Assuring facility or site set up including support personnel are prepared for day(s) event(s).
  • Assists with the development implementation and tracking of a marketing strategy for esports programming.
  • Consolidates and collects all records of payments/fees for programs and outstanding balances.
  • Handles cash and utilizes point-of-sale software to complete transactions.
  • Performs administrative tasks completion of enrollment forms tracking attendance activity registration account maintenance account creation and account collections.
  • Performs customer service duties such as greeting guests and answering questions in person and over the phone; explains Parks and Recreations programs and services.
  • Coordinates and schedules facility usage and maintenance.
  • Can trouble-shoot minor problems propose solutions and establish work-orders.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.

Welcome to the official website of the city of Aurora. Aurora is Colorado's third largest city with a diverse population of more than 398,000. The "Gateway to the Rockies" is a bioscience, transportation and aerospace hub with award-winning parks, open space and cultural amenities.
